#f5781e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f5781e is composed of 96.1% red, 47.1%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 25.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 53.9%. #f5781e color hex could be obtained by blending #fff03c with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f5781e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f5781e has RGB values of R:245, G:120,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.88,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16087070.

Shades and Tints of #f5781e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fef4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5781e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928881 is the less saturated color, while #fe7715 is the most saturated one.
